Losing data is feared by many companies who rely on the information held in a computer's memory banks, although providers of managed services are available to prevent this from happening.

More and more records are being added to online applications instead of recorded in paper format. Virtual representations have many advantages over hard copy documents that have formed the backbone of companies in the past. For example, they do not need to be stored in large warehouses like paper documents usually are.

In addition, when it comes to finding facts and figures held within them, it is easier to search through internet files rather than flicking through lots of pages. A vulnerability that both paper and virtual records share is that they can both be lost or degraded in some way. Hard copy files may be destroyed by floods and fires, while computer files could suffer due to server failings and hackers.

To limit chances of the latter scenario, expert data storage firms provide backup options so data is safely kept and can be referred to if necessary. Rather than keeping the task of backing up data in-house, some businesses prefer to call in specialists who are able to carry this out and give peace of mind to their clients. Employees are then freed up to take on other assignments as measures are put in place to automatically get information secured against circumstances that would otherwise lead to degradation of data.

Expert firms get the required information stored in specialist centres for safekeeping. The original data can be backed-up from a variety of remote and local sites. Updates on the facts and figures held in the vaults are regularly sent over so details are current. Following this, the backups are monitored often and reports about them are made available, so clients are able to keep track of the process as it occurs.
